Understanding Drug and Alcohol Detox in Corona, New Mexico

Drug Detox is a term meaning the medical care of discomforting withdrawal symptoms which happens when an individual dependent on drugs or alcohol and then quits using the substance abruptly. When an individual has become dependent on substances such as heroin, liquor, methamphetamine, crack, lortab, dilaudid, valium etc., it can be damaging both physically and psychologically. When a person that has developed an addiction to a narcotic and decides to quit consuming, or ceases using the narcotic because of lack of availability, the individual will begin to feel withdrawal symptoms. Depending on the narcotic being used, a wide range of withdrawal symptoms may be felt by the individual, which can include anxiety, nausea, depression, insomnia, paranoia, fatigue, chills, muscle pain, sweats, cramps, tremors, and runny nose, just to list a few. A drug detox center is usually provided in Corona, New Mexico as a supervised inpatient program.

Although it is fortunate that drug detox centers are on hand in Corona to help people with withdrawal symptoms, drug detoxification is not a long lasting solution for addiction. Drug detoxification is only one of many steps to successfully handle addiction. A long term treatment plan is the only proven method to fully recover from an addiction.
